Be a part of CHC's WildPaths Citizen Science Project in Fletcher. We’ll walk one of the many roadways considered a wildlife crossing site looking for signs of animals and roadkill. WildPaths is an opportunity for community members to help gather much needed data on where wild animals are crossing our roads; both successfully and unsuccessfully. Find out how the WildPaths project will help inform decision making when it comes to wildlife and transportation. Participants will learn how to share random observations or how to Adopt a Roadway for the project.
